Buffalo Chicken Dip

I was attending a company bottle share and decided to go on a cooking rampage. I asked a few people if they could have anything in the world, what would you like to eat. The answer...Buffalo Chicken Dip. A standard pairing with hot sauce is IPA or a Lager, but I decided to change it up a bit. Add some depth with a dry cider with a hint of residual sweetness to round out the hot sauce. 

 

Ingredients

 

1 lb Cream Cheese

1 C  Ranch Dressing

3/4 C Hot Sauce (I used Franks for this)

1/4 C Kurant Bees, or other dry cider

1 lb Shredded Chicken

​

​

Directions

​

It's really this easy: Whip all the ingredients together...DONE! Using a food processor worked best to mix the cream cheese and make it smooth, then add the chicken. You can also add shredded cheddar on top and bake it for 10 minutes!
